From 4d4060f37b57af3a61742d68cc35f1bffaa83a08 Mon Sep 17 00:00:00 2001 From: Tulir Asokan Date: Thu, 5 Sep 2024 02:29:39 +0300 Subject: [PATCH] legacymigrate: fix handling empty content hashes --- cmd/mautrix-telegram/legacymigrate.sql |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/cmd/mautrix-telegram/legacymigrate.sql b/cmd/mautrix-telegram/legacymigrate.sql index aa870a22..4f848b0b 100644 --- a/cmd/mautrix-telegram/legacymigrate.sql +++ b/cmd/mautrix-telegram/legacymigrate.sql @@ -156,7 +156,7 @@ SELECT -- only: sqlite (line commented) -- json_object ( - 'content_hash', encode(content_hash, 'base64') + 'content_hash', CASE WHEN content_hash IS NULL THEN '' ELSE encode(content_hash, 'base64') END ) -- metadata FROM message_old INNER JOIN portal_old ON mx_room=portal_old.mxid